Taiko's Shasta Upgrade Promises Significant Cost Reductions

Taiko's Shasta Upgrade Promises Significant Cost Reductions

user avatar

by Nguyen Van Long

6 months ago


The upcoming Shasta upgrade is poised to revolutionize the operational efficiency of the Taiko rollup, promising substantial cost reductions that could reshape the landscape of blockchain transactions, as enthusiastically stated in the publication.

Significant Decrease in Block Proposal Costs

Internal data reveals that the cost of proposing a block on the Taiko rollup will plummet from around one million gas units to a mere 45,000 gas units, marking an impressive 22-fold decrease. This dramatic reduction is expected to significantly lower transaction fees for end-users, making blockchain technology more accessible to the general public.

Anticipated Decline in Proving Costs

In addition to the reduced block proposal costs, proving costs are also anticipated to decline sharply. This dual reduction in operational expenses not only enhances the user experience but also encourages broader adoption of the Taiko rollup, positioning it as a competitive player in the evolving blockchain ecosystem.
